Tripple Raspberry
Our second high gravity beer that we've released at Millstream is our Tripple Raspberry. We released it Oct 1st during Oktoberfest, hope you've had a chance to try it. This beer is a fruity Belgian Triple that is full of raspberries of course! It is an unfiltered ale that is heavy, sweet and gives a warm feeling all at once. It is about 9.5% ABV and is only available on tap or in liter bottles at the brewery. You might even be lucky enough to find it on tap in a couple other places.
